QA Engineer at Eureka Robotics


Company presentation

Empowered by Robotics and A.I. research from NTU Singapore and MIT, Eureka Robotics delivers robotic software and systems to automate tasks that require High Accuracy and High Agility (#HAHA).

With offices in Singapore, Vietnam, Japan, and distribution partners in China and the USA, Eureka Robotics prides itself on helping clients, globally, achieve vastly improved productivity, lower costs, and better safety. Common uses include precision-handling, assembly, inspection, and other domains.

Roles

As an QA Engineer at Eureka Robotics, you will be working to improve our product quality by developing manual and automated tests, assisting our engineering team and customers in investigating issues in production, and creating reports of issues discovered during testing or production.

Job Responsibilities

  • Create detailed, comprehensive, and well-structured automated and manual test cases for software developed in house
  • Increase and maintain automation scripts in the internal CI/CD system
  • Doing exploratory testing for features in each release
  • Doing hardware testing on company products
  • Plan and execute stress testing activities of software drivers for industrial devices
  • Plan and execute testing of computer vision and robotic algorithms
  • Assist in troubleshooting issues faced by our engineers and customers on-site.
  • Create reports for development teams on issues detected during testing and in production.
  • Working with POs in amending user stories, requirements for better product quality

Qualifications

1. Must-have skills:

  • At least 2 years of general testing with minimum 1 year experience in automated software testing
  • Good knowledge about testing methodologies: regression testing, integration testing, smoke testing, exploratory testing…
  • Good test designing using testing techniques: Boundary Value Analysis, Equivalence Class Partitioning, Decision Table, Error Guessing…
  • Experience in one programming language: Python (preferred), Java …
  • Experience in one or more automation testing libraries and frameworks (Selenium, Cucumber, Appium, Robot (preferred), Cypress ,Playwright..etc.)
  • Working within agile development teams with a BDD/TDD approach and supporting the developers to do the shift-left testing in the early stage.
  • Good ability in troubleshooting and consulting the development team
  • Should be a good team player, willing to learn, willing to improve
  • Proficient in English commands (4 skills).

2. Nice to have:

  • Familiar with CI/CD tools like Jenkins
  • Desktop application testing or hardware related testing
  • Familiar with Linux environment, shell scripts …
  • Familiar with AI-related or Robotics-related product
  • Bachelor or Master’s Degree in Computer Science/Computer Engineering or related fields (e.g. Electrical Engineering, Mechanical Engineering,... with significant exposure to Computer Science)
  • Experience working with electrical or mechanical automation systems
  • Prior experience in robotics or robotics-related technologies, such as motion planning, control, computer vision and AI
